DPP holds a special place for me because it (and HGSS) were the only games where I got something close to the "authentic" Pokemon experience.

RBY and GSC I didn't really have friends who were into it enough to play much with them.
Didn't play any gen 3 at all.

But with DPP and HGSS I had two friends start at the same time as me-- we all picked different starters, we regularly battled, traded, and all that, going at roughly the same speed through the game. It was really very fun and makes me appreciate like... philosophically, what Pokemon is going for with the multiple versions, beyond just being a cash grab. Peak Pokemon for me.

I'm very sparing with "aged" comments

To me it's mostly for mechanics that are obviously better executed on better tech (like Goldeneye with bad fps) or mechanics that always sucked but were given a pass because we didn't have better options (like Dragon Warrior's menus)

I'd say Ocarina's stuff is as good as it's ever been. I never liked it back then either.

I just wish you saw more of Cecil's character development. He's pretty much the same character as a Paladin and a Dark Knight. Kinda wish the game started a bit before the Mysidia "this is wrong" thing. Give him a few missions where it's of dubious morality but kinda accepted and then have him have that "whoa" moment there.

We never really know Cecil before he "turns good" and that really hurts the character for me.
